Lincoln College

ACADEMIC ADMINISTRATOR

Lincoln College invites applications for the post of Academic Administrator with effect from July 2008. This is the senior position in the College Office which comprises a small, friendly, and busy team who handle all the College's academic administration needs under the direction of the full-time Senior Tutor. It offers an interesting and varied opportunity to work with a wide range of people both inside and outside the College, exercising excellent interpersonal, organizational, and IT skills.

Applicants must have a first degree or equivalent, relevant administrative experience, and excellent IT skills. Previous experience of Collegiate and/or University administration would be an advantage.

This is a full-time post. The salary will be within the range £27,466 to £33,780 a year, according to experience, and the post-holder is entitled to thirty days' leave a year, free lunch on duty, and membership of the Universities Superannuation Pension Scheme (USS).

Further particulars, including a full job description, selection criteria, and details of the application process can be obtained from the Rector's PA, Mrs Sally Lacey, Lincoln College, Oxford, OX1 3DR (or email sally.lacey@lincoln.ox.ac.uk). The closing date for applications is 6 June 2008.

Lincoln College is an equal opportunities employer.
